Understanding the Breadth of Employment Law:
Work law encompasses a large range of legal concerns connected to the employer-employee connection. These laws are developed to make certain fair treatment, avoid discrimination, and safeguard employees' legal rights. An work lawyer is skilled in these laws, which include:
Wrongful Termination: Illegal discontinuation of work in violation of contracts or anti-discrimination regulations.
Discrimination: Illegal discrimination based on race, sex, age, faith, disability, or various other safeguarded characteristics.
Wage and Hour Disputes: Issues connected to unsettled wages, overtime pay, and base pay infractions.
Harassment and Aggressive Work Environment: Unlawful harassment or creation of a hostile workplace based upon protected features.
Family and Medical Leave Act (FMLA): Legislations connected to employee leave for medical or household reasons.
Employment Agreement and Arrangements: Lawful documents describing the terms of employment.
Whistleblower Protection: Regulations that secure workers who report prohibited or dishonest tasks.

The Value of Timely Action:
In work legislation cases, time is important. Statutes of constraints enforce due dates for submitting legal actions, and proof can become shed or weakened gradually. Seeking lawful depiction promptly is critical to preserving your rights and maximizing your possibilities of success.
